opposing forces
there's a restlessness in the way you move your hands, like a storm's brewing beneath your bones                                 and when I compare it to my still calmness.     my serene disposition- we're lunatics for thinking that                               you and me.        us and we.   he and she. could ever work out.                                   but we do.
